PAT Testing

Portable appliance testing (or PAT testing) is a method of check electrical equipment and appliances in order to make sure they are safe. This helps to avoid injuries and accidents when the equipment is being used, and reduces the risk of serious problems.

While the law might differ from one country to another, there are some basic requirements that businesses should adhere to. These requirements are laid out in the UK's Health and Safety at Work Act and Electricity at Work Regulations. These laws are mainly enforced through the promotion of risk assessments and encouraging employers to implement PAT testing guidance as part of the process.

Companies and organizations that use lots of electrical appliances should consider scheduling regular PAT tests as a way to comply with the legal requirement. It is not always necessary to test all the devices in a business but it is important to keep track of the items that should be tested again and when.

There are many kinds of testers available that can be used to accomplish this. Some are simple devices for businesses to use in their offices to test their electrical appliances, whereas other testers have more features. Some can even be programmed for specific tests like the current test for a protected conductor or testing for touch currents, however they are only suitable for users with more experience.

Most appliances have the two most important tests for basic testing which are earth continuity and resistance. This involves testing the insulation of appliances to ensure that it is safe for reuse.

Another test is the earth continuity test which allows the transfer of a current from the mains plug of an item of electrical equipment to its exposed metal parts to determine if there are issues with the connection to the earth pin of the mains plug. This is usually done by connecting the device to an electrical mains cable connected to the instrument.
